Transaction 187564898d0bcbeb0fb4b868c258626621f87244c4e33d02ef3b61091e5b63d2
1 Input
1 Output
-
187564898d0bcbeb0fb4b868c258626621f87244c4e33d02ef3b61091e5b63d2:0
- value
- 2634010
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4626f75270f116af0c47e104f652758fc885bf7 OP_EQUAL
- address
- 3M416d2fmyqHfo3PE27eW8B3YNR8PDM73G